Scarification in sub-Saharan Africa: social skin, remedy and medical import.

Roland Garve1, Miriam Garve2, Jens C Türp1,3, Julius N Fobil4, Christian G Meyer5,6,7.   

Abstract

Various forms of body modification may be observed in sub-Saharan Africa. Hypotheses and theories of scarification and tribal marking in sub-Saharan Africa are described, plus the procedure of scarification, examples from several African countries, assumed effects in prevention and treatment of diseases, and the medical risks resulting from unsterile manipulation.
